HKU5-CoV-2, the new bat coronavirus in China sparks global concern: Know its symptoms and how does it spread
Synopsis
The
new bat coronavirus, HKU5-CoV-2, found in China has sparked concerns
among health officials and has triggered panic. HKU5-CoV-2 has
similarities to the virus responsible for the Covid-19 pandemic,
according to a study published in Cell. HKU5-CoV-2 belongs to the
merbecovirus subgenus, which also includes the MERS virus. The newly
discovered virus can bind to human ACE2 receptors.
